After a decade in Paris, Carmela (30) returns to her fishing village in Quezon province. She buys the old, abandoned fish market to build “Casa Cielo” —a high-end café. The villagers see her as a conquistadora (colonizer). The biggest resistance comes from Gabriel (32), her former boyfriend. He is now a bitter, hard-drinking fisherman who lost his scholarship to culinary school the very week she left.

The is more than a genre; it is a mirror reflecting the Filipino psyche regarding love, loyalty, and pride. These films remind us that love and hate are two sides of the same coin. One moment you are in a passionate embrace; the next, you are plotting the downfall of your ex-lover’s career.
At its heart, "Bitter Passion" is a cautionary tale about the thin line between intense love and destructive obsession. The story follows a standard but highly effective melodrama formula, elevated by raw, contemporary filmmaking sensibilities.
